Visa Types for BVI Travellers

Short Stay

15-Day eVisa

Best for quick trips, short holidays, or brief family visits.

Standard

30-Day eVisa

Good choice for most tourism and business travel plans.

Extended

60-Day eVisa

Suitable for longer stays where extra travel time is needed.

Common Application Mistakes to Avoid

Data Check

Passport Number Errors

Enter your passport number exactly. One wrong character can delay or reject your request.

File Quality

Blurred Uploads

Use clear and complete images. Cropped or blurry files often cause additional review time.

Travel Dates

Inconsistent Itinerary

Ensure your form dates match your flight and accommodation records before submission.
